Фундаменты автоматизации с помощью сценариев

Автоматизация монотонных процедур обеспечивает экономить время и сокращать число ошибок при реализации регулярных операций. Скрипты представляют собой серию инструкций, которые компьютер производит без вмешательства человека.

Современные операционные платформы поддерживают разнообразные механизмы для формирования автоматических сценариев. Пользователи могут формировать команды для обработки файлов, управления информацией или коммуникации с веб-ресурсами. Даже простые умения мостбет казино предоставляют возможности для совершенствования рабочих операций.

Освоение механизации начинается с осознания принципов работы компьютера и построения директив.

Что такое сценарии и зачем они необходимы

Сценарий является собой утилиту, написанную на интерпретируемом языке программирования. Такие приложения исполняются построчно без заблаговременной компиляции в машинный код. Интерпретатор обрабатывает любую директиву и тотчас исполняет нужное операцию.

Ключевое назначение сценариев состоит в механизации задач, которые человек исполняет ручками. Обработка значительных массивов сведений, переименование файлов, генерация отчётов — все эти операции можно поручить программе. Автоматизированный сценарий выполнит работу быстрее и безошибочнее.

Скрипты применяются в системном управлении для конфигурации серверов и контроля параметрами. Разработчики применяют их для сборки проектов и установки программ. Аналитики разрабатывают скрипты для анализа информации и генерации визуализаций.

Преимущество скриптовых языков заключается в простоте синтаксиса и скорости написания. Написать функциональный мостбет можно за несколько минут, не углубляясь в трудные принципы программирования. Готовые библиотеки расширяют возможности и позволяют решать узкоспециализированные операции без разработки программы с нуля.

Какие проблемы можно автоматизировать

Механизация обхватывает широкий набор повседневных операций в разных сферах работы. Скрипты берут на себя однообразную работу и высвобождают время для реализации созидательных операций. Грамотно настроенный mostbet может исполнять сложные последовательности действий без неточностей.

Наиболее популярные области применения автоматизации содержат нижеперечисленные сферы:

  • Манипуляции с файловой системой: групповое переименование документов, классификация по категориям, ликвидация повторов, архивация старых данных
  • Обработка текстовых информации: анализ логов, получение данных из документов, оформление отчётов, подстановка текстовых отрывков
  • Коммуникация с базами данных: экспорт и импорт строк, генерация страховочных дубликатов, удаление неактуальных данных, создание аналитических срезов
  • Контроль платформ: проверка работоспособности служений, мониторинг потребления мощностей, рассылка уведомлений при возникновении неполадок
  • Интеграция служб: согласование данных между приложениями, автоматическая выкладка материалов, корректировка сведений на сайтах

Любая фирма выявляет собственные проблемы для механизации в связи от особенностей бизнес-процессов. Затраты времени в создание сценариев компенсируются неоднократно за благодаря повышения производительности труда.

Востребованные языки для создания скриптов

Python занимает ведущие положения среди скриптовых языков благодаря понятному синтаксису и богатой экосистеме библиотек. Язык подходит для анализа данных, веб-скрейпинга, автоматизации испытания и машинного обучения. Начинающие программисты изучают Python быстрее иных языков.

Bash является эталоном для механизации в операционных системах Linux и macOS. Командная интерфейс дает регулировать файлами, процессами и системными параметрами. Системщики разрабатывают скрипты для страховочного копирования, наблюдения серверов и внедрения систем.

PowerShell представляет собой производительный средство автоматизации в инфраструктуре Windows. Язык встроен с операционной системой и обеспечивает подключение к модулям через объектную структуру. Технические специалисты используют PowerShell для контроля Active Directory и установки серверов.

JavaScript задействуется для автоматизации через инфраструктуру Node.js. Программисты формируют средства сборки проектов, обработки файлов и связи с API. Выбор нужного мостбет казино определяется от операционной системы, специфики операций и существующего опыта программирования.

Работа с файлами, папками и информацией

Операции с файловой системой формируют основу преимущественного числа автоматизированных скриптов. Скрипты дают генерировать, переносить, дублировать и устранять документы по заданным критериям. Утилита перерабатывает тысячи документов за секунды.

Переименование документов по паттерну помогает создать структуру в коллекциях и медиатеках. Сценарий добавляет префиксы, модифицирует расширения или генерирует названия на базе метаданных. Фотографы организуют изображения по датам съёмки.

Розыск и фильтрация сведений превращаются несложными задачами при задействовании автоматизации. Приложение находит документы по объему, дате генерации или контенту. Данные розыска записываются в файл или перемещаются в изолированную директорию.

Просмотр и запись контента документов дают варианты для анализа информации. Сценарии получают требуемые строки из логов, объединяют сведения из разных источников или преобразуют структуры. CSV-файлы преобразуются в JSON, текстовые файлы делятся на части.

Формирование запасных дубликатов через mostbet обеспечивает сохранность критичной данных. Автоматизированный скрипт архивирует сведения по графику и стирает старые версии.

Механизация повторяющихся действий

Повторяющиеся действия отнимают значительную порцию трудового времени и способствуют к утомлению сотрудников. Автоматизация таких операций повышает продуктивность деятельности и сокращает шанс ошибок. Утилита выполняет однотипные операции с стабильной аккуратностью.

Заполнение форм и образцов документов делается мгновенным при задействовании сценариев. Сценарий вставляет данные из хранилища в нужные графы и записывает итоги в указанном формате. Финансисты сберегают часы на подготовке отчётности.

Передача цифровых сообщений по списку получателей автоматизируется через простой мостбет с персонализацией содержания. Программа вставляет имена адресатов, прикрепляет документы и мониторит статус доставки. Специалисты по маркетингу распространяют тысячи уведомлений за мгновения.

Корректировка данных в таблицах происходит по заданному алгоритму без мануального внесения. Скрипт извлекает сведения из источника, контролирует правильность параметров и сохраняет правки. Менеджеры обретают актуальные информацию самостоятельно.

Мониторинг правок на интернет-ресурсах обеспечивает контролировать изменения цен или выход свежих товаров. Утилита проверяет страницы по расписанию и уведомляет юзера о обнаруженных изменениях.

Сценарии для веб-разработки и SEO-задач

Веб-разработка активно задействует автоматизацию для оптимизации процессов создания и сопровождения сайтов. Скрипты преобразуют стили, минифицируют код, улучшают графику и формируют разработки. Программисты настраивают компиляцию единожды однократно и сберегают время при любом обновлении.

Анализ веб-страниц обеспечивает получать упорядоченные сведения из сайтов для обработки. Программа получает HTML-код, обнаруживает нужные блоки по идентификаторам и сохраняет данные в базу данных. Аналитики накапливают цены соперников или характеристики товаров самостоятельно.

SEO-специалисты применяют сценарии для анализа технического положения порталов. Автоматизированный mostbet сканирует разделы, находит поврежденные линки, анализирует мета-теги и определяет быстроту подгрузки. Отчёты формируются в удобном виде.

Создание XML-карт портала облегчается через механизацию. Приложение сканирует организацию ресурса, создает перечень URL-адресов и генерирует документы соответственно стандартам поисковых платформ.

Контроль позиций в поисковой результатах контролирует движение сортировки главных запросов. Сценарий извлекает информацию из поисковых систем и отображает модификации в схемах.

Планировщики операций и регулярный запуск скриптов

Регулярное выполнение сценариев по графику трансформирует разовую автоматизацию в постоянный цикл. Планировщики заданий стартуют утилиты в установленное время без присутствия юзера. Система работает постоянно и производит операции в отсутствии человека.

Cron является собой базовый планировщик в Unix-подобных системах. Управляющие настраивают план через специальный формат, указывая минуты, часы и дни для старта. Сервер механически создаёт страховочные дубликаты каждую ночь или стирает служебные документы еженедельно.

Планировщик задач Windows обеспечивает графический оболочку для установки автоматизированного запуска программ. Пользователи формируют правила по времени или действиям системы. Корпоративные сети применяют планировщик для актуализации программного софта.

Узкоспециализированные инструменты расширяют функции базовых планировщиков. Платформы контроля задачами реализуют связи между скриптами и обработку неполадок. Правильно настроенный мостбет казино регулирует последовательность действий и перезапускает неудавшиеся операции.

Фиксация данных деятельности помогает контролировать проблемы и анализировать продуктивность автоматизации.

Безопасность и проверка сценариев перед активацией

Запуск непроверенных скриптов составляет серьёзную опасность для безопасности платформы и сведений. Опасный программа может стереть файлы, похитить информацию или дать атакующим вход к компьютеру. Контроль контента утилиты перед запуском делается обязательным шагом.

Изучение первоначального программы обеспечивает понять принцип работы скрипта и обнаружить странные команды. Опасные операции охватывают устранение системных документов, корректировку реестра или отправку данных на удаленные серверы. Даже несложный мостбет требует скрупулезного изучения перед первоначальным стартом.

Испытание сценариев в обособленной обстановке минимизирует риски при проверке непроверенного программы. Виртуальные системы создают защищенное пространство для тестов. Разработчики запускают свежие скрипты на тестовых информации и контролируют данные.

Использование электронных сертификатов гарантирует аутентичность скриптов от надежных источников. Операционные платформы останавливают выполнение несертифицированного кода по умолчанию.

Периодическое обновление интерпретаторов закрывает уязвимости в системе исполнения. Устаревший мостбет казино может включать баги, которыми воспользуются атакующие.